Sinuses are hollow air spaces within the bones around the area of the nose. When these sinuses get blocked due to the formation of bacteria, they get inflamed and cause infection and pain. This pain refers to sinusitis. Sinusitis are of four types –
- Acute: This comes with symptoms like pain on various parts of your face, running or congested nose. It starts on its own and does not get cured before 10-15 days.
- Subacute: This inflammation usually lasts from 3-8 weeks.
- Chronic: In this case, the problem might persist from 8-10 weeks, and sometimes even more.
- Recurrent: People suffering with this, experience the attack several times in a year.
Causes: It usually starts with inflammation triggered by cold, allergy attack or irritant. Virus, bacteria, pollutants & fungi are other causes of sinusitis
Symptoms: Facial pain and pressure, blocked nose, nasal discharge, reduced sense of smell, fatigue, congestion, cough & sore throat
